## Runbook: Spanwise diff viewer (large-file mode)

Hey plugin folks — if your extension hooks into Spanwise's chunked rendering, keep in mind that files over the soft limit get streamed through the Coldbarrow tokenizer instead of being loaded whole. Your plugin will see partial buffers, so don't assume the full document is in memory. Before filing a bug, check that your local setup matches ours. Here are the settings we run with.

deployment values, fahap-hahaf:
[casdor]
port = 9200
region = south-2
host = casdor.qirvanworks.corp
timeout_ms = 3000
retries = 4

**Handover: Brambleknife Stale-Branch Bot**

For the weekly sync: the bot now prunes branches idle 90+ days, opens a summary issue each Monday, and skips anything labeled `keep`. Varla fixed the false-positive on release branches last sprint. Remaining task: add dry-run output to the dashboard. If the bot's service account locks out, restore access with the recovery passphrase below.

recovery phrase for tahop-bajef: praix-oliius

## Alert: Relevance Tuning Drift — Quillsearch Index

This alert fires when live ranking scores deviate more than 8% from the baselines recorded in the tuning notes for the current release train. It usually indicates that a synonym pack or boost profile shipped without a corresponding notes update. Please hold the release until the Quillsearch relevance team confirms the drift is intentional and annotates the notes accordingly. Confirmation requests should be sent directly to the relevance duty inbox.

escalation mailbox, yajef-hawef: druix@qirvancorp.internal

Handover — holiday opening hours

Hi Tomas, covering the essentials before I'm off. Over the Midwinter closure (24th–2nd), Ferngate House runs reduced hours: building open 09:00–15:00, reception unstaffed after noon. Courier deliveries go to the side entrance only. Team assistants coming in on skeleton days should enter via the side door, which is keypad-controlled during the closure. The holiday-period door code is below.

door code, kawip-bagap: bdg-HQEWH-4